    $29 ISP-BWI on Southwest

    From Travelzoo:
    $29 -- Baltimore from Long Island (each way) *
    Washington D.C. from Long Island

    Travel dates: Through September 12

    Top 20 deal - sells out quickly!

    Southwest Airlines is offering $29 each way flights between Islip, Long Island and Baltimore/Washington International Airport. This is definitely one of the best fares we've seen for this route. Plus, Islip is only about an hour by train from New York City - just a few minutes more than JFK!
    Travel is valid on select dates through September 12. Book by May 11.
